In Favor of the DS
Curtis and I don't often disagree but we do this time. I've got a DS 4-piece 8-weight ... I never figured out why Sage changed it because it works and works well ... Of course, it isn't "pretty." Fight the fish with the butt of the rod and it won't break...
I'd save myself a few bucks and got with the DS. I would apply the savings to buying very good fly lines... Doug |
